          • D Offline
            DirkS
            last edited by Nov 5, 2016, 12:46 PM

            @done as discribed above by @cpramhofer (thanks to you :) ) i created the monitor_on and off.sh script.
            With FHEM i’m polling the PIR status and use a DOIF to call on or off. Because my homeautomation depends in FHEM i have much more control instead of using a MM module, i switch much more devices with the PIR as well. I have several Pi’s with FHEM installed so it is also on the PI for the Mirror.
